๐Ÿ“ฆ Products

RD Series Carbides: Excellent balance of characteristics (Wear and Strength).

RV/RL Series Carbides: Specialized for Impact Resistance.

RF Series Carbides: Good balance of Wear and Chipping Resistance.

RX Series Carbides: Combined Impact Resistance and High Fracture Toughness.

F Series Carbides: High Hardness and High Strength.

NA Series Carbides: Non-Magnetic with excellent Corrosion Resistance.

KA / KEA Series Carbides: Excellent Oxidation Resistance.

W Series Carbides: High durability and toughness for Warm/Hot Forging.

P Series (PRF/PRD/PRV) Carbides: Low Friction and Seizure Resistance.

๐Ÿ“Œ Why Choose Sanalloy?

Best For: EV & Automotive Component Suppliers, Precision Electronic Mold Makers, and Deep Drawing Houses struggling with tool adhesion (galling) or chemical corrosion.

  • PRD12N Grade: This is Sanalloy’s new grade specifically designed for motor core molds, essential for the production of electric vehicle (EV) components. It offers superior seizure resistance, wear resistance, and corrosion resistance, making it highly effective for punching electromagnetic steel sheets and significantly extending die life.
  • Dual-Protection Metallurgy: Typically, carbide is either hard or corrosion-resistant, rarely both. Sanalloy developed the MBN Alloy to solve this trade-off. It maintains high hardness for wear resistance while withstanding chemical degradation, making it the perfect solution for molds exposed to corrosive resins or harsh lubricants that would eat away at standard grades.
